The Rugrats Theory is a fan interpretation of Rugrats.Originally a Creepypasta-inspired narrative, the theory proposes that the titular Rugrats are actually figments of Angelica Pickles' imagination.Through various means, each titular baby ends up becoming manifested in Angelica's delusions. The "Rugrats Theory" suggests that all of the babies that appear in the series are figments of series antagonist Angelica Pickles' imagination and are derived from tragedies and accidents: Chuckie died in birth, Tommy was a stillborn, Kimi was made up, and the DeVille twins were the result of an abortion.
